Appropriate Preposition:

  • Jump at ( আগ্রহ সহকারে গ্রহণ করা ) Do not jump at the offer.
  • End in ( শেষ হওয়া ) All his plans ended in smoke.
  • Burst out ( ফেটে পড়া ) He burst out laughing at my joke.
  • Listen to ( শোনা ) Listen to the news on the radio.
  • Quick of ( চটপটে ) He is quick of understanding.
  • Divide between ( ভাগ করা (দুটি বা দুজন) ) Divide the apple between Raqib and Shafique.
